The grandaddy of Ride the Lightning releases. This thing weighs almost 10lbs (sorry, you will have to foot the shipping cost!) With 6 CDs, 3 full LPs and a DVD along with lyric book 3 posters and a 72 page book cataloging the 1984-1985 time frame of a pre-Master of Puppets, still young, Metallica who had just signed to Elektra records here in the US. Not many of these are still sealed. Most are opened and there are very few of those for sale as is. This is a very low numbered #5131 out of 30,000. (RtL has sold over 6 Million copies worldwide and only 30k of these were printed worldwide, so that gives you an idea of scarcity.
